Hi HN, Wanted to share a project I made over the weekend - a real-time fascism tracker. The site fetches recent news from trusted sources, filters it for keywords related to fascism and the current US administration, and then sends it to GPT-4o for classification according to the 14 characteristics of fascism described by Dr. Lawrence Britt. With the rapid pace of news in the US, especially post-election, it’s hard to keep up. I built this site so you can quickly see important topics and draw parallels with similar historical events. I've long been into finding deals on government auction sites (seizures, surplus sales etc.) - right now for example San Diego DHS is selling 26 tons of lead shot, with bidding starting at $1,000 ¯\_(ツ)_/¯ It has historically been extremely tedious though: scanning dozens of janky sites which have interminable page loading times; back buttons take you all the way back to the homepage etc. The site I built - GovAuctions - lets you search every government surplus auction at once. You can filter by location, category, and price, save items to a watchlist, and get alerts when new auctions…

I built this several months ago as I was interested to see how the titles of posts evolve/change on HN. It turns out lots of titles are edited every day (in both subjectively and objectively good and bad ways!) and I've found it interesting to see how titles have evolved. The whole thing is automated and is built around a Ruby script that pulls down the titles on the front page at a frequent interval. Any titles for specific story IDs that change get tracked and rendered out to a static HTML page hosted on Netlify. It runs by itself without incident so far. This has been on Show HN…

TLDR; - Quality News is a Hacker News client that provides additional data and insights on submissions, notably, the upvoteRate metric. - We propose that this metric could be used to improve the Hacker News ranking score. - In-depth explanation: https://github.com/social-protocols/news#readme The Hacker News ranking score is directly proportional to upvotes, which is a problem because it creates a feedback loop: higher rank leads to more upvotes leads to higher rank, and so on... → ↗ ↘ Higher Rank More Upvotes ↖ ↙ ← As a consequence, success on HN depends almost…

Hey HN, We analyzed 4,010,957 Hacker News submissions to find what actually makes posts perform well. Key findings: - 93.2% of posts never hit 50 points - Top 1% starts at 270 points - Certain keywords boost engagement by 1000%+ Built a free tool that scores your launch title and predicts viral potential: [link] The entire 4M post dataset is available as a single 700MB .mv2 file if you want to run your own analysis.

Hey HN community, I built a tool that helps optimize your post for hitting the first page of Show HN. How it works: I used a Hugging Face dataset of all Hacker News posts from the past 3 years and trained a model that predicts how successful your post might be. There's still a lot of randomness on HN, so nothing is guaranteed, but the tool helps optimize your post for higher odds. A couple of interesting findings: - GitHub repo links work x3 better than regular domains - Open-source tools have a steady virality rate (13.9% - one of the highest) - "I built" outperforms "We built" - Using…

Hello HN! About 1.5 years ago we published an idea on how to improve the Hacker News ranking algorithm (https://felx.me/2021/08/29/improving-the-hacker-news-ranking...). The main idea was to counteract the rank-upvotes feedback loop by using attention as negative feedback. We received very valuable input from the HN community (https://news.ycombinator.com/item?id=28391659), and have since come up with something that we think could be a real contribution: the upvoteRate metric. upvoteRate is an estimate of how much more or less likely users are to…

I analyzed 10 years of Hacker News data (2016-2025) to track Show HN submission trends. - Show HN posts went from ~900/month (2016-2019) to 3,315 in Dec 2025 - Share of all stories: 2.4% (2016) → 12.8% (Dec 2025) - Notable spikes: COVID-19 (2020), AI boom (2023), and accelerating growth through 2024-2025 Data source: HackerBook (144k Show HN posts / 3.4M total stories)
